Description
Set against the backdrop of the late 19th century, this gripping narrative unfolds as a stunning invasion of Earth by Martian forces is unleashed upon an unsuspecting humanity. With advanced technology and a chilling indifference towards life on our planet, the Martians embark on a relentless campaign to conquer, leaving devastation in their wake. H. G. Wells masterfully depicts the chaos and fear that grips the world, capturing the struggle of humans against a powerful enemy that seems invincible.
Through vivid imagery and compelling character portrayals, the story follows the desperate attempts of survivors as they witness their world descending into turmoil. Amidst the terror, some individuals display remarkable resilience, showcasing the indomitable human spirit in the face of annihilation. The narrative's tension grips readers, forcing them to confront profound themes of survival, the fragility of civilization, and the potential perils of unchecked progress.
As the epic saga unfolds, readers are invited to reflect on the implications of such an encounter, contemplating what it truly means to be human when confronted with another civilization's might. It is a timeless exploration of fear, ingenuity, and the endurance of the human soul.
